Output 07dadc178623d0c7688d226c87fa13eb1957120b7032282fb3f594585e8b696e:0

value
1862436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b50d1ce98473f74b9f2e04d7cf261c230f49b3 OP_EQUAL
address
3QpVmjfESwU9q6LW3zVeLFpbXrWNqq5YBY
transaction
07dadc178623d0c7688d226c87fa13eb1957120b7032282fb3f594585e8b696e
spent
true